Crystal Springs Police Department, Mississippi
End of Watch Saturday, August 13, 2005

Police Officer Timothy Webster was shot and killed after conducting a vehicle stop on Jackson Street.
The suspect fled on foot when the vehicle was stopped. Officer Webster pursued the suspect on foot and was able to catch up to him on Kendall Lane. The two struggled and the suspect was able to gain control of Officer Webster's service weapon. The suspect shot Officer Webster just above his bullet-resistant vest, and killed him
The suspect escaped but was apprehended the next day. He was charged with murder. The suspect's mother and another woman were also arrested and charged with aiding a fugitive for their attempts to hide him.
The suspect was convicted of first degree murder and sentenced to life without parole on October 4, 2007.
Officer Webster was a U.S. Army veteran and had served with the Crystal Springs Police Department for two months. He is survived by his wife, three children, brother, three sisters, and two nieces.
